In today’s digital age, server hardening is crucial to ensure the security of your website or application. Hardening a server involves implementing various security measures to reduce vulnerabilities and protect against cyber threats. In this article, we’ll discuss the best practices for hardening a server to enhance its security and make it SEO friendly.
Why is Server Hardening Important?
A server is the heart of your online presence, and its security is critical for your business’s success. The consequences of a data breach can be severe, resulting in loss of sensitive information, damage to your reputation, and loss of customer trust. Moreover, search engines such as Google prioritize websites that prioritize security and privacy, meaning that a secure website is more likely to rank higher in search engine results pages (SERPs).
Best Practices for Hardening a Server
1. Regularly Update Your Server
Keeping your server up to date is critical to preventing cyber attacks. Hackers often exploit vulnerabilities in outdated software to gain unauthorized access to your server. Therefore, it’s essential to regularly update your server’s operating system and software to patch any security flaws.
2. Use Strong Passwords and Two-Factor Authentication
Using strong passwords and two-factor authentication adds an extra layer of security to your server. Passwords should be complex, unique, and changed regularly. Additionally, two-factor authentication, such as SMS verification or a biometric scan, ensures that only authorized users can access your server.
3. Limit Access to Your Server
Limiting access to your server is a fundamental principle of server hardening. You should only grant access to users who need it and remove it promptly when it’s no longer necessary. Moreover, you can use firewalls and VPNs to limit access to specific IP addresses and prevent unauthorized access.
4. Use Encryption
Encrypting your data is another critical step in server hardening. You should use Transport Layer Security (TLS) or Secure Sockets Layer (SSL) to encrypt data in transit and use encryption to protect data at rest, such as in databases or backups.
5. Configure Your Firewall
A firewall is a critical security measure that monitors and controls network traffic to and from your server. Configuring your firewall correctly is crucial to preventing unauthorized access and blocking malicious traffic.
6. Use Intrusion Detection and Prevention Systems (IDS/IPS)
IDS/IPS systems monitor your network for suspicious activity and block potential attacks. These systems can help identify and prevent cyber threats before they cause any damage to your server or website.
7. Regularly Backup Your Data
Regular backups ensure that you can recover your data in the event of a cyber attack or hardware failure. You should back up your data regularly and store it offsite to ensure that you can recover it even if your server is compromised.
Server hardening is a crucial step in ensuring the security of your website or application. By following these best practices, you can reduce vulnerabilities, prevent cyber attacks, and improve your server’s SEO performance. Moreover, implementing server hardening measures is essential to build customer trust and protect your reputation. By investing in server hardening, you can ensure that your online presence is secure, reliable, and SEO-friendly.